Transaction 72a39ab7ee3dbd1e83e548e12d68f679f9538e69a52e846c32b28ebac36e3691

1 Input
2 Outputs
  • 72a39ab7ee3dbd1e83e548e12d68f679f9538e69a52e846c32b28ebac36e3691:0
  • value  52374566
    address  3JjJBSeoGzccvoQsWV8688rxBkXhJLLofG
  • 72a39ab7ee3dbd1e83e548e12d68f679f9538e69a52e846c32b28ebac36e3691:1
  • value  8272955
    address  38JerwMVJQ9nwDsFCBSEKCmGdy1a2mTXcb